New patents are issued by the USPTO on Tuesdays. Today's Spotlight Patents concern blockchains (distributed ledgers, smart contracts) and rights management broadly construed. Assigned to Walmart, the first patent addresses techniques for managing reservations and deliveries for a docking station. Assigned to Americorp Financial, the second patent addresses techniques for generating a customized view of a blockchain transaction.
10,423,921, "Delivery reservation apparatus and method," assigned to Walmart.
Abstract
In some embodiments, apparatuses and methods are provided herein useful to manage reservations and deliveries for a docking station. More specifically, the various embodiments described herein track spaces on a docking station to determine whether one or more spaces are available when requested by a delivery device. Each space on the docking station has a corresponding capacity unit for each location on the docking station. The transactions for the capacity units are tracked in a ledger, with available capacity units indicating an open location on the docking station or contracted out capacity units indicating that either the location has a locker secured thereto or that the location is reserved for a future delivery.
10,425,426, "Customized view of restricted information recorded into a blockchain," assigned to Americorp Investments LLC
Abstract
Systems, methods, and software are disclosed herein to generate a customized view of a blockchain transaction. A blockchain of block entries requested by a plurality of users from user devices is maintained in a distributed network of nodes. The block entries each comprise a plurality of data portions that are each associated with an access level. A request to view one or more data portions of a block entry is received which includes an access code associated with at least one access level. The access code in the request is evaluated with the blockchain of block entries to identify one or more data portions associated with the access level. A customized view of the block entry is generated which includes the one or more data portions associated with the access level.